Output e95a176ad15423ae132b141350429ab16296df4d016dd599f323d995cdb8884e:10
- value
- 153281224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abb15dad4be1bc443311be17cb59ff92e4c7a818 OP_EQUAL
- address
- MPYzFqJy4zP8WbvAo2M4tX63YhBLLje4B5
- transaction
- e95a176ad15423ae132b141350429ab16296df4d016dd599f323d995cdb8884e
- spent
- true